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ith concentrates on providing a large range of services connected to automotive locks and keys. These experts are trained to manage various concerns, including:
-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have actually bro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and supply you with brand-new keys.
-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can rapidly and safely unlock the doors without causing damage.
-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can avoid your car from beginning. A car locksmith can diagnose and repair these problems.
- Transponder Key Programming: Modern cars and trucks frequently use transponder keys, which require specialized programming to operate.
- Car Lock Installation: If you need to set up new locks or improve the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can assist.
Factors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services
The cost of car locksmith services can differ based upon a number of aspects:
- Type of Service: Different services have different rate points. For instance, a basic lockout service may cost less than programming a transponder key.
- Time of Day: Emergency services, specifically those supplied late in the evening or early in the early morning, typically featured a higher cost.
- Area: Urban locations generally have more locksmith professionals and might provide competitive prices, while rural areas may have less options and greater costs.
- Type of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end cars typically require customized tools and know-how, which can increase the expense.
- Reputation and Experience: More knowledgeable and respectable locksmith professionals might charge more, however they often supply higher quality service.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How much does it cost to unlock a car?A: The expense to unlock a car can range from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ending upon the complexity of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Factors such as the time of day and the kind of vehicle can also influence the rate.
Q: Are car locksmith professionals covered by insurance?A: Some car insurance coverage policies cover the expense of locksmith services. It's crucial to examine your policy or call your insurance coverage supplier to confirm protection.
Q: How do I confirm a locksmith's qualifications?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ance details. In addition, you can consult your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to ensure they are genuine and have an excellent performance history.
Q: Can I utilize a routine locksmith for car services?A: While some routine locksmith professionals might use car locksmith services, it's typically best to use a specific car locksmith. They have the particular tools and training required to manage automotive locks and keys successfully.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?A: If you lose your car keys, contact a car locksmith to get a new set made. They can likewise extract any broken keys and program transponder keys. It's also an excellent concept to file an authorities report and contact your car insurance coverage supplier.
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to arrive?A: The reaction time can vary depending on the locksmith's availability and your area. Some locksmith professionals offer 24/7 services and can arrive within 30 minutes, while others might take longer.
